Central Brazil Mission


HISTORY:

         Earl and Ruth Anne entered Brazil in July, 1969.  They were raised in southwest Ohio and attended the Cincinnati Bible Seminary.  They are now completing thirty-nine (39) years of serving on the foreign mission field.  Since 1973 they have lived in Goiânia, Goiás a city of 1.5 million people and just three hours from Brasilia, the country’s capital. Marlon and Yara joined C.B.M. in 2003 when Marlon became the minister of the Novo Horizonte Church; the mother church of the ministry.  They are now being trained and discipled to lead the mission in the future.  They just spent a school year in the U.S. working with the Mandarin Christian School and Christ´s Church Mandarin in Jacksonville, Florida.
